Setup

Firstly, fork this repository to your personal GitHub, and clone your forked copy locally.

Secondly, open the cloned repository in an editor of your choice. Make a copy of the .env-example file and name it .env. As an aside, if you are using VSCode (which we recommend), the following are some extensions that will help you during development:

  • dbaeumer.vscode-eslint
  • christian-kohler.npm-intellisense
  • esbenp.prettier-vscode
  • Prisma.prisma
  • bradlc.vscode-tailwindcss

Thirdly, open the project's base directory in the terminal of your choice and run npm run setup. This installs the necessary dependencies and initializes a database for us.

Lastly, to view your current code in a dev server, run npm run dev and go to localhost:3000/ to view your current code in website form. Try to only have this command running in one terminal, or you may have some weird behavior occur.

This will be a little complicated, since the completion/deletion functionality should be set in the Todo component, even though the state is stored in the TodoList component. You can go about it in a couple of ways (for your reference, 1 & 2 are referred to as prop drilling):

  1. Write two generic functions in TodoList that take an id parameter and returns a function that will do the proper completion/deletion state update on todos, pass those functions into Todo as another prop, and call the functions in Todo (the function defined in the TodoList component will have access to variables defined in TodoList!)
  2. Directly pass the necessary state updating function(s) to Todo, and write the completion/deletion logic in Todo
  3. (not recommended here but most "scalable" and "best practice") Extract the todos state into a context and update any usages of todos to use the context's state. Then, use the context within Todo to update todos

Congrats on getting this far! Our app is looking great, and it functions well -- as long as we keep our tab open. However, you'll notice that if we refresh the page or switch browsers, our todo list gets reset!

To fix this, we're going to introduce a little bit of server logic. (In case you're curious, localStorage wouldn't work, since localStorage isn't shared across browsers.)

Our database was handily setup in the setup script defined in our package.json and should have been run earlier. There is an action.ts file in src/app/Database that has some server actions that need to be implemented and then called in our components.

Implement each of the server actions provided, and refactor all the code written so far to call the server actions for creating tasks, updating tasks, and deleting tasks, trying to fetch data in server components where possible and updating relevant states when necessary.
